Create a Focal Point

garden

One of the first things that you can do to upgrade the look and feel of your back yard is to create a focal point. Your focal point, which tends to draw attention to the eyes, can be as grand as a gazebo or a shed, or as simple as a dramatically planted container. Maximize Vertical Walls

garden

Another thing that you can do to enhance the look of your back yard is by maximizing your vertical walls. Explore on how you will be able to design a vertical wall garden that can add greenery to your space. This is particularly advantageous for small yards with lots of concrete areas. You don’t have to be wary because there are numerous vibrant plants that are suitable for a hanging garden.

Plant Strategically

garden

In order to make sure that your garden thrives with plants and greens, you need to ensure that you plant strategically. This entails the need for you to get to know which plants require the most sunlight, so that you can position them in the area of your back yard with maximum sunlight exposure.

Splash of Color

garden

Lastly, don’t be afraid to put on a splash of color in your garden to accentuate the natural beauty of your plants. You can either paint the fences of your walls, or get garden chairs in bold colors. There is also the option for you to keep neutral tones around vibrant flowers. The key is in maintaining balance in the hues that you use.
